The Shift in Responsibility00:00:22
College marks the transition where faith becomes a personal choice rather than a habit reinforced by family or community. Being a Christian in this environment means shifting from a default cultural position to being in the minority.
The Struggle to Fit In00:02:04
Trying to balance the desire for popularity with a commitment to Christ often leads to internal conflict. Real growth begins when one stops trying to satisfy both the secular world and their faith, accepting that they may not fit in with common college trends.
Finding Authentic Community00:04:07
Building a firm foundation involves intentionality in finding a church and a community of like-minded peers. It is emphasized that Christian friends do not solve every life problem, but they provide necessary support for the journey.
Redefining the College Experience00:08:32
Instead of focusing on superficial goals or comparing experiences to social media, students should place their identity in Christ. While faith may not make college easier, it ultimately makes the experience better by providing stability and purpose.
